3,804 Steps to Miles, By Height
The 2,000-steps-per-mile figure above is a flat average. Stride length actually scales with height, so the same 3,804 steps covers a different distance depending on how tall the walker is.
| Height | Distance |
|---|---|
| Short (~5'2") | 1.54 mi |
| Average (~5'7") | 1.67 mi |
| Tall (~6'2") | 1.84 mi |

Where 3,804 Steps Ranks
Activity levels are commonly grouped by daily step count. Here's where 3,804 steps falls.
| Activity Level | Daily Steps |
|---|---|
| Sedentary | Under 5,000 |
| Low Active | 5,000–7,499 |
| Somewhat Active | 7,500–9,999 |
| Active | 10,000–12,499 |
| Highly Active | 12,500+ |
Did You Know?
A large 2017 smartphone study across 46 countries (published in Nature) found average daily step counts varying enormously by country, roughly 4,000 to nearly 6,900. The researchers found that inequality in step counts within a country predicted obesity rates better than the average did.
George Meegan's 1977-1983 trek from the southern tip of South America to Alaska covered roughly 19,000 miles on foot the entire way, still recognized as the longest unbroken walking journey ever recorded.
